Our website is designed with accessibility in mind and we work toward WCAG 2.1 AA compliance. This means we aim to present information in a way that is perceivable, operable, understandable, and robust for a wide range of users. We regularly review page structure, colour contrast, text readability, and content layout so that the site remains usable for people with different needs, including those using assistive technologies.
We want the accessible Sutton Man And Van experience to be straightforward for everyone. That includes people who use screen readers, voice control, magnification tools, or alternative input devices. We also aim to keep language clear and navigation simple, so visitors can quickly understand our services and the steps involved in getting support.
Our site is intended to support screen-reader support through a logical heading order, meaningful page structure, and descriptive text where appropriate. We avoid relying only on visual cues to communicate important information. Images should be accompanied by suitable alternative text, and content should remain understandable even when visual styling is reduced or removed. This helps users who depend on assistive software to access information about Sutton removals and related services.
We also aim to provide full keyboard navigation so visitors can move through menus, links, forms, and interactive elements without a mouse. Focus indicators should remain visible, and controls should be usable in a predictable order. If any part of the site is difficult to reach by keyboard, we treat that as an accessibility issue and work to resolve it promptly. This is especially important for users who navigate via switch devices or other non-pointer methods.
